Gavin de Becker, et al. v. UHS of Delaware, Inc., dba Desert Springs Hospital Medical Center
Paid petition · Supreme Court of Nevada, No. 85968 · judgment September 19, 2024
Before the decision, well below the 4.1% base rate, with no standout signals pointing toward a grant.
Questions presented
-
Does the Public Readiness and Emergency Preparedness Act of 2005, 42 U.S.C. §§ 247d-6d, 247d6e (the “PREP Act”), immunize medical providers from liability for acts and omissions that do not involve “a “covered countermeasure” under the PREP Act?
-
Does administering a “covered countermeasure” at some point during treatment automatically immunize a medical provider against liability for unrelated acts and omissions? (i)
